Seattle’s upcoming mental health crisis center on Capitol Hill will be run by the same provider running a center in Kirkland, King County announced Thursday.
The county named the Capitol Hill center’s operator as Connections Health Solutions, an Arizona-based behavioral health company that expanded to Washington last year when it opened the Kirkland center.
